Anotasi Dokumen Master di .NET dengan GroupDocs.Annotation: Panduan Lengkap
Perkenalan
Dalam lanskap digital saat ini, pengelolaan anotasi dokumen yang efektif sangat penting bagi bisnis yang mengandalkan dokumentasi seperti kontrak hukum atau manual teknis. GroupDocs.Annotation untuk .NET menyederhanakan proses ini dengan memungkinkan Anda menyimpan dokumen beranotasi dengan mudah sambil mempertahankan kontrol versi dan jalur keluaran khusus. Tutorial ini memandu Anda memanfaatkan GroupDocs.Annotation untuk .NET untuk mengelola alur kerja dokumen Anda secara efisien:
- Menyiapkan GroupDocs.Annotation untuk .NET
- Menyimpan dokumen beranotasi dengan pengidentifikasi versi yang unik
- Memuat dokumen dari FileStream untuk pemrosesan yang lancar
Prasyarat
Sebelum memulai, pastikan Anda memiliki hal berikut:
- Kerangka .NET atau .NET Inti/5+ terinstal di komputer Anda.
- Pengetahuan dasar tentang pemrograman C# dan keakraban dengan struktur proyek .NET.
- Visual Studio 2017 atau yang lebih baru untuk pengembangan. Selain itu, instal GroupDocs.Annotation untuk .NET di proyek Anda seperti yang akan segera kami bahas.
Menyiapkan GroupDocs.Annotation untuk .NET
Untuk mengintegrasikan GroupDocs.Annotation ke dalam proyek .NET Anda:
Konsol Pengelola Paket NuGet
Jalankan perintah berikut:
dotnet add package GroupDocs.Annotation --version 25.4.0
Akuisisi Lisensi
GroupDocs menawarkan berbagai pilihan lisensi:
- Uji Coba Gratis: Jelajahi fitur dengan versi uji coba.
- Lisensi Sementara: Permintaan evaluasi lanjutan.
- Pembelian: Beli lisensi penuh untuk penggunaan komersial. Kunjungi halaman pembelian atau meminta lisensi sementara sesuai kebutuhan.
Inisialisasi dan Pengaturan Dasar
Berikut cara menyiapkan GroupDocs.Annotation di proyek C# Anda:
using System;
using GroupDocs.Annotation;
string documentPath = "YOUR_DOCUMENT_DIRECTORY/input.pdf";
using (Annotator annotator = new Annotator(documentPath))
{
// Tambahkan anotasi di sini.
}
Potongan kode ini menginisialisasi Annotator
kelas, mempersiapkan aplikasi Anda untuk menangani dokumen.
Panduan Implementasi
Menyimpan Dokumen Beranotasi dengan Jalur Keluaran Kustom
Ringkasan
Menyimpan dokumen beranotasi dengan jalur khusus memastikan setiap versi dapat diidentifikasi dan diambil secara unik. Fitur ini menggunakan aliran file dan GUID untuk manajemen yang lancar.
Panduan Langkah demi Langkah
1. Tentukan Jalur Input dan Output
string documentPath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"input.pdf");
string outputPath = Path.Combine("YOUR_OUTPUT_DIRECTORY", "result.pdf");
Penjelasan: Jalur ini menentukan lokasi dokumen masukan Anda dan tempat menyimpan versi yang diberi anotasi. 2. Memuat Dokumen Menggunakan FileStream
using (FileStream fs = new FileStream(documentPath, FileMode.Open))
{
using (Annotator annotator = new Annotator(fs))
{
// Tambahkan anotasi di sini.
Penjelasan: Itu FileStream
memuat dokumen Anda ke dalam memori, yang memungkinkan GroupDocs untuk memprosesnya.
3. Simpan dengan Pengidentifikasi Versi Unik
annotator.Save(new SaveOptions { OutputPath = outputPath, Version = Guid.NewGuid().ToString() });
}
}
Penjelasan: Langkah ini menyimpan dokumen beranotasi di jalur khusus dan menambahkan pengidentifikasi versi unik menggunakan Guid
.
Tips Pemecahan Masalah
- Masalah Akses Berkas: Pastikan aplikasi Anda memiliki izin baca/tulis untuk direktori yang ditentukan.
- Jalur File Tidak Valid: Periksa ulang nama direktori dan keberadaan file.
Memuat Dokumen dari FileStream
Ringkasan
Memuat dokumen melalui FileStream berguna saat bekerja dengan file di lokasi non-standar atau skenario dalam memori.
Panduan Langkah demi Langkah
1. Buka Dokumen sebagai FileStream
string documentPath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"input.pdf");
using (FileStream fs = new FileStream(documentPath, FileMode.Open))
{
// Dokumen sekarang dapat diakses untuk diproses.
}
Penjelasan: Pendekatan ini memungkinkan GroupDocs menangani dokumen secara fleksibel dan efisien.
Masalah Umum
- Kesalahan Aliran: Verifikasi jalur berkas dan pastikan aliran terbuka dengan benar sebelum operasi lebih lanjut.
Aplikasi Praktis
GroupDocs.Annotation dapat diintegrasikan ke dalam berbagai aplikasi:
- Manajemen Dokumen Hukum: Tingkatkan penanganan dokumen firma hukum Anda dengan memberi anotasi pada kontrak dengan komentar yang tepat.
- Platform Pendidikan: Izinkan instruktur memberi anotasi pada kiriman siswa dalam platform digital.
- Ruang Kerja Kolaboratif: Tingkatkan kolaborasi tim dengan memungkinkan banyak pengguna untuk menambahkan anotasi dan melacak perubahan.
Pertimbangan Kinerja
Untuk mengoptimalkan kinerja saat menggunakan GroupDocs.Annotation:
- Manajemen Memori: Buang aliran dan contoh anotator segera setelah digunakan.
- Penggunaan Sumber Daya: Pantau penggunaan sumber daya aplikasi, terutama dengan dokumen besar.
Kesimpulan
Anda telah menguasai penyimpanan dokumen beranotasi dengan jalur keluaran khusus dan memuatnya melalui FileStreams menggunakan GroupDocs.Annotation untuk .NET. Pertimbangkan untuk mengeksplorasi fitur lebih lanjut seperti ekspor anotasi atau pengintegrasian GroupDocs ke dalam aplikasi yang lebih besar untuk meningkatkan produktivitas. Langkah selanjutnya dapat mencakup mempelajari lebih dalam jenis anotasi tingkat lanjut atau bereksperimen dengan berbagai format dokumen. Siap untuk membawa keterampilan manajemen dokumen Anda ke tingkat berikutnya? Cobalah!
Bagian FAQ
1. Apa itu GroupDocs.Annotation?
GroupDocs.Annotation adalah pustaka .NET yang memfasilitasi anotasi pada berbagai format dokumen dan menyederhanakan proses peninjauan.
2. Bagaimana cara menginstal GroupDocs.Annotation untuk .NET?
Instal melalui NuGet Package Manager atau .NET CLI seperti yang ditunjukkan sebelumnya. Pastikan Anda memiliki nomor versi yang benar.
3. Dapatkah saya menggunakan GroupDocs.Annotation dengan tipe file lain?
Ya, ia mendukung banyak format termasuk PDF, Word, Excel, dan banyak lagi.
4. Apa itu FileStream di C#?
A FileStream
memungkinkan membaca dari atau menulis ke berkas menggunakan aliran untuk manipulasi berkas yang efisien.
5. Bagaimana cara menangani dokumen besar secara efisien?
Optimalkan kinerja dengan mengelola memori secara efektif dan memproses dokumen dalam potongan-potongan yang mudah dikelola jika perlu.
Sumber daya
- Dokumentasi: Dokumentasi GroupDocs.Annotation .NET
- Referensi API: Referensi API Anotasi GroupDocs
- Unduh: Rilis GroupDocs untuk .NET
- Beli Lisensi: Beli Lisensi GroupDocs
- Uji Coba Gratis: Coba Uji Coba Gratis GroupDocs
- Lisensi Sementara: Minta Lisensi Sementara
- Forum Dukungan: Forum Dukungan GroupDocs Dengan mengikuti panduan ini, Anda telah membekali diri dengan pengetahuan untuk mengelola anotasi dokumen secara efektif menggunakan GroupDocs.Annotation for .NET. Selamat membuat kode!